Description

Thetford House and barn is a farmhouse and barn dating from the early 18th century, with extensions from the mid 18th century and early 19th century. The building is constructed of coursed limestone rubble, featuring ashlar quoins and pecked dressings, along with red brick and render. It has a slate roof with stone coped gables, two gable ashlar stacks, and a red brick rear range. There is a rendered 19th-century front addition that has a hipped Collyweston slate roof.

The house is two storeys high with a three-bay front, originally five bays, as indicated by the blocked openings. The central entrance features a 20th-century door flanked by single 20th-century glazing bar windows. On the first floor, there are three similar windows. All openings have 20th-century concrete lintels and pecked ashlar quoined reveals. To the left, there is a taller two-storey, two-bay 19th-century wing that has two tall glazing bar sashes on each floor.

At the rear, there is an altered 18th-century red brick wing and an attached barn that has a steeply pitched stone coped gabled Collyweston roof and two sliding double doors. The roof also features two hipped dormers.
